The difference between 2 supplementary angles is 121.54. What are the angle measures?

Answers

Answer: 150.77 and 29.23

==============================================

Explanation:

x = larger angle

y = smaller angle

x-y = difference of the angles = 121.54

x-y = 121.54 is one equation

x+y = 180 is the other equation since supplementary angles always add to 180 (they form a straight line).

We have this system we're working with

[tex]\begin{cases}x-y = 121.54\\x+y = 180\end{cases}[/tex]

Add the equations straight down.

x+x = 2x-y+y = 0y, the y terms go away121.54+180 = 301.54

We're left with this reduced equation

2x = 301.54

Divide both sides by 2 to isolate x

x = 301.54/2

x = 150.77

Use this to find the value of y

x-y = 121.54

150.77-y = 121.54

-y = 121.54-150.77

-y = -29.23

y = 29.23

Or we could say

x+y = 180

150.77+y = 180

y = 180-150.77

y = 29.23

---------------

Summary:

x = 150.77 and y = 29.23 are the two angles.

I'll let you check the answers.

How do I explain 1.82 divided by 140.14

Answers

Answer:

  0.012987...(6-digit repeat)

Step-by-step explanation:

You explain it the same way you explain any division of decimal numbers.

The usual procedure is to adjust both numbers so that the divisor is an integer. Here, that is accomplished by multiplying each number by 100. This makes the problem ...

  1.82/140.14 = 182/14014

Now, division proceeds in the usual way. The first non-zero quotient digit will appear in the hundredths place. The quotient is a repeating decimal with a 6-digit repeat. You recognize the repeat as soon as you see 182 as a remainder.

__

Additional comment

The ratio reduces to ...

  [tex]\dfrac{1.82}{140.14}=\dfrac{182}{14014}=\dfrac{1}{77}=0.\overline{012987}[/tex]

Find the smallest non-zero whole number that is
divisible by 315, 378 and 392.

Answers

Answer:

  52920

Step-by-step explanation:

You have described the Least Common Multiple (LCM) of the three numbers. That can be found by considering their unique factors. The LCM is the product of the unique factors, 2³, 3³, 5, 7².

  315 = 3×3×5×7

  378 = 2×3×3×3×7

  392 = 2×2×2×7×7

The LCM will be ...

  2×2×2×3×3×3×5×7×7 = 52920

The smallest natural number divisible by 314, 378, and 392 is 52920.
